How they compare
Bahrain currently reports 2.98 against 2.94 in Ghana, a difference of 0.04.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Bahrain ahead.
Bahrain ranks 103rd and Ghana ranks 105th of 211 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Bahrain averaged higher in 1 and Ghana in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bahrain | Ghana |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 5.47 | 5.36 | 0.11 | Bahrain |
| 2010s | 3.5 | 6.77 | 3.27 | Ghana |
| 2020s | 1.85 | 3.09 | 1.24 | Ghana |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
